Understanding Effect Size: At the heart of Hattie's research is the concept of effect size. This statistical measure helps quantify the impact of various educational interventions. Effect size is calculated by comparing the mean of the experimental group with the mean of the control group, and then dividing this difference by the standard deviation of the control group. The result provides a standardized measure of how effective an intervention is.
The Threshold for Success: Hattie identifies an effect size of 0.40 as the "hinge point," meaning that interventions with an effect size above 0.40 are considered to have a significant impact on student achievement. This threshold serves as a benchmark for evaluating educational practices. For instance, an effect size of 0.60 or higher suggests that an intervention is highly effective and worth implementing.
Key Findings from Hattie's Research: Hattie’s meta-analysis includes thousands of studies and provides a comprehensive list of educational strategies ranked by their effect sizes. Here are a few notable findings:
Feedback: With an effect size of 0.73, feedback is one of the most powerful tools in education. It allows students to understand their performance and make necessary adjustments.
Direct Instruction: This method, characterized by structured and explicit teaching, has an effect size of 0.60. It emphasizes clear objectives and frequent assessment.
Classroom Management: Effective classroom management strategies, which include maintaining a positive learning environment and establishing clear rules, have an effect size of 0.52.
Self-Reported Grades: Students who set their own learning goals and assess their own progress show an effect size of 0.56, demonstrating the importance of student self-regulation.

Challenges and Considerations: While Hattie’s research provides valuable insights, it’s important to remember that effect sizes are not the only factor to consider. Context, implementation fidelity, and individual student needs also play critical roles. Additionally, some interventions may have a high effect size in certain contexts but be less effective in others. Therefore, educators must adapt strategies to fit their unique classroom environments.
